TAIR curator summary | Encodes a member of the PXPH-PLD subfamily of phospholipase D proteins. Regulates vesicle trafficking. Required for auxin transport and distribution and hence auxin responses. This subfamily is novel structurally different from the majority of plant PLDs by having phox homology (PX) and pleckstrin homology (PH) domains. Involved regulating root development in response to nutrient limitation. Plays a major role in phosphatidic acid production during phosphate deprivation. Induced upon Pi starvation in both shoots and roots. Involved in hydrolyzing phosphatidylcholine and phosphatidylethanolamine to produce diacylglycerol for digalactosyldiacylglycerol synthesis and free Pi to sustain other Pi-requiring processes. Does not appear to be involved in root hair patterning. |
